Reasons to select BB over EB?

After seeing a post "BB vs EB" it seemed that the vast majority of people would consider a EB gig to be better than most BB opportunities aside from some BB groups (GS TMT/FIG). I've heard all the reasons why EBs are better: pay/exit opps (in general)/job security/pure M&A exposure. And I myself picked an EB over a top BB for my SA however, that was due to the people of the firm and not really about pay/exit opps.

So can anyone tell me in what aspects are BBs better than EBs and why would someone with both offers take a BB aside from culture and layman prestige.
